SOUTHERN SECTION GIRLS’ SOCCER PLAYOFFS : Esperanza Scores Early to Stop Marina

Although Marina dominated Esperanza for 78 minutes, the Aztecs controlled the two minutes that counted.

Esperanza (14-6-1) scored the game’s only goal in the opening two minutes and posted a 1-0 victory over Marina (17-4) in a Southern Section Division 4-A first-round girls’ soccer match Friday at Esperanza High School.

Esperanza advanced to a second-round match against Simi Valley, a 2-0 winner over St. Lucy’s Friday.

Rachelle Mandel headed Kathy Haerle’s free kick into the left corner of the net to give the Aztecs a 1-0 lead in the game’s second minute.

“After we scored that first goal, our whole team just thought defensive,” Esperanza Coach Phyllis Scarborough said. “And with all the back-door runs Marina makes, I was scared.”

Marina had numerous scoring opportunities, finishing with 26 shots on goal. The Vikings also had 10 second-half corner kicks but couldn’t put the ball in the net.

Esperanza goalie Jennifer Bryant had 17 saves to help keep the Vikings at bay. Bryant has played in only seven games this season after recovering from January knee surgery.

Bryant, an honorable mention All-Empire League selection last season, has five shutouts in her six starts this season.
